Abstract -- Broadband single pole four throw (SP4T)
switches in coplanar (CPW) waveguide based on cantilever
or clamped - clamped switches have been developed for use
in space application. All the devices are manufactured on
high-resistive silicon using surface micro-machining
technology. The SP4T switches provide very good
performance in terms of insertion and return loss and
isolation over a wide frequency band. These switches are
intended to be used as building block for large order
switching matrices for satellite applications. Full wave
simulations as well as measured RF performances are
reported. The two are in a very good agreement, showing
high performance for all SP4T typologies. Depending on the
specific design, insertion loss between 0.5 and 1.25dB, return
loss between 20dB and 26dB and isolation between 35dB
and 50dB has been obtained in the 0-6 GHz frequency band.
